In Turkiye, the medical detachment of the Ministry of Defense provided medical assistance to 3860 citizens

According to the information service of the Ministry of Defense of the Republic of Uzbekistan, today, on March 6, qualified servicemen of the Ministry of Defense of Uzbekistan returned to Tashkent, who took part in the elimination of the consequences of the earthquake in Turkiye for 24 days.
On behalf of the President of the Republic of Uzbekistan, Supreme Commander-in-Chief of the Armed Forces Shavkat Mirziyoyev, on February 8 this year, a medical detachment of the Ministry of Defense, consisting of qualified military personnel, left for the Republic of Turkiye to assist in the aftermath of the earthquake and provide medical assistance to victims of the earthquake.
For almost a month, Uzbek servicemen provided humanitarian assistance to the Turkish people affected by the earthquakes and supported them in difficult times. During this time, they provided medical assistance to a total of 3,860 citizens.
